問題タブ [jonas]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
spring - JOnAS 5.2.2 での Hibernate アプリを使用した Spring MVC - 検証例外
JOnAS で Java EE アプリをデプロイしようとしていますが、まだNo Validation Provider Found
例外が発生します。このアプリを Glassfish や JBossAS などの他の Java EE コンテナーで実行しようとしましたが、すべて問題ありませんでした。追加した :
また
しかし、結果は同じでした。
スタックトレースは次のとおりです。
java - Java EE 監視アプリケーション
Java EE と C++ で作成された他のアプリケーションやサーバーを監視するために、JONAS サーバー上に Java EE でアプリケーションを作成したいと考えています。
だから私は私を助けるためにAPIか何かを探しています。
java - Java アプリケーション サーバーのライフサイクル中にどのような問題が発生する可能性がありますか?
実際、私は高可用性が必要な Java アプリケーション サーバー上でソフトウェアを設計しています。そのため、アプリ サーバーのエラーを検出する監視システムも含める予定です。おそらくJMXを使用してそれを行います。では、Java アプリケーション サーバーのライフサイクル中に何が起こる可能性があるのでしょうか? 何を監視する必要がありますか?
- OutOfMemoryError が発生した場合は?
- アプリサーバーに十分なメモリがあるか?
ほかに何か???
返信ありがとう
java - Maven でエラーがビルドされる
Eclipse の下で、Java コードにいくつかの変更を加えた後、自動的にクリーン/ビルドを作成し (4 つのプロジェクトをクリーンアップ)、エントリ ポイントを含むプロジェクトの GWT コンパイルを作成します (このプロジェクトの GWT コンパイル)。 、そして最後にエントリポイントを含むプロジェクトの WAR をエクスポートします (エクスポート / War ファイル)。Jonas サーバーのディレクトリ webapps/autoload に WAR を配置する必要があります。Jonas サーバーを停止してから、Jonas サーバーを再起動します。
問題は、Internet Explorer 経由でアプリケーション サーバーにアクセスしたときに、コードの最後の変更が存在しないことです。ただし、localhost:8080 でアプリケーションを実行すると存在します。
私の WAR は以前のコンパイルから作成されたのではないかと思います。それが問題だと思いますか?そして、私は問題を見てきました:3つのプロジェクトのプロジェクトをきれいにするとき、私はこの非常に一般的なエラーがあります:
まず、この非常に一般的で説明されていないエラーを解決するにはどうすればよいですか?
次に、このエラーが私の問題の原因だと思いますか (最後の変更が適用されていないアプリケーション)。
第三に、そうでない場合、変更を見つけてアプリケーションに統合するにはどうすればよいですか?
これは Maven Console の全内容です:
ワークスペースの 4 つのプロジェクトをビルドする前に停止します。
この Maven コンソール (太字) では、私のワークスペースの少なくとも 2 つのプロジェクト、alizesWeb と clas2coreGwt で、1 つにビルド エラーがあることがわかります。
そして、これらのエラーが上記の問題の原因ではないかどうかを尋ねます(最後の変更がアプリケーションサーバーに配置されていません)
これは、「ログ エラー」ビューに書き込まれたエラーです。
code>eclipse - アプリケーションサーバーに存在しない最後のコード変更
Eclipse(MavenとGWTを使用)では、4つのプロジェクトがあります。
Javaコードソースに変更を加えました。アプリケーションサーバー(Jonasサーバー)に変更を加えるために
、すべてのプロジェクトのクリーン/ビルドを自動的に行い、
次にエントリポイントを含むプロジェクトのGWTコンパイルを行いました。
最後に、エントリポイントを含むこのプロジェクトのエクスポートWAR。
このWARをアプリケーションサーバー(Jonas)に配置し、サーバーを停止して再起動すると
、最後の変更がサーバーに存在しません!!!
ただし、ローカル(localhost:8080)でGWTアプリケーションを実行すると、最後の変更が存在します。
あなたはそのような状況に遭遇しましたか?何がそれを説明できますか?
ありがとう
java - コンテナ内でJavaEEアプリケーションをデバッグする方法は?
JavaEEアプリケーションの1つに非常に難しい問題があります。
JoNaSをアプリケーションコンテナとして使用していますが、問題は同期と厳密に関連しています。コンテナ内でアプリケーションをデバッグすることは可能ですか?それを達成するためにプロジェクトをどのように編成する必要がありますか(たとえば、JoNaSソースをどこに配置するか)?
windows - Jonas 5.2.4 が端末から起動しない
現在、W7 Entreprise の Jonas 5.2.4 (サーバーの「フル」バージョンを使用) に Web アプリをデプロイしようとしています。それに応じて、すべての環境変数が設定されます。問題は次のとおりです。Eclipse JUNO(4.2)では、Jonas Support Plugin(5.1.2)を使用して、サーバーが起動しますが、デプロイに失敗します(明らかに、mavenと上記のプラグインとの間の既知の互換性の問題)。コンソールで実行しますが、jonas を起動しても基本的jonas start
にこれが返されます:
コンソールに次のメッセージを表示する
-Djava.awt.headless が JVM に渡される引数であることはわかっていますが、Windows がそれをファイルへのパスと見なす理由がわかりません。
誰かがこの問題に遭遇したことがありますか、または解決策を提供できますか?
編集:クリーンな再インストールは4回後に機能しました(理由はわかりません)が、ロードするサービスを変更するためだけに何かを行った唯一のファイルはjonas.propertiesだったので、何が起こったのか知りたいですジョナスが始まったとき。
jakarta-ee - コンテナーがサポートしていない CDI アプリケーションに統合しますか?
私のアプリケーションは、 をサポートしJOnAS 5.2.2
ていないにデプロイされています。その上で使用する必要があります。アプリケーションのWAR部分での使用方法は知っていますが、一部はわかりません。CDI
EJB
CDI
EJB
CDI
EJB
サポートしていないコンテナCDI
にアプリケーションのサポートを追加する方法はありますか?EJB
私の上司は、サーバーをサポートするバージョンにアップグレードしません。
[編集] 私は CDI-WELD を使用しています: 私は解決策の始まりを見つけました:
私は次のように DAOTest に別のものを注入してテストしました:
}
動作しますが、EntityManager は @PersistenceContext で解決されません。@Produce アノテーションを使用する必要があると思いますが、その方法がわかりません。